# Ceramic Innovations in Modern Architecture

## The Evolution of Ceramic Materials in Architecture

Ceramic materials have been a cornerstone of architectural design for centuries. From ancient clay bricks to modern porcelain tiles, ceramics have evolved to meet the changing needs of architects and builders. Today, ceramic innovations are pushing the boundaries of what is possible in modern architecture, offering new solutions for sustainability, durability, and aesthetic appeal.

## Sustainability and Eco-Friendly Solutions

One of the most significant advancements in ceramic technology is its contribution to sustainable architecture. Modern ceramics are often made from recycled materials, reducing waste and conserving natural resources. Additionally, ceramic tiles and panels can improve energy efficiency by reflecting sunlight and reducing the need for artificial cooling. This makes them an excellent choice for green building projects aiming for LEED certification.

## Durability and Longevity

Ceramics are renowned for their durability, making them ideal for both interior and exterior applications. Advances in ceramic manufacturing have resulted in materials that are more resistant to wear, weather, and chemical damage. This longevity not only reduces maintenance costs but also ensures that buildings retain their aesthetic appeal for decades.

## Aesthetic Versatility

The aesthetic possibilities with modern ceramics are virtually limitless. With advancements in digital printing and glazing techniques, architects can now specify ceramic tiles and panels in a wide range of colors, patterns, and textures. This allows for greater creativity in design, enabling the creation of unique and visually striking buildings.

## Innovative Applications

Modern ceramics are being used in innovative ways that were previously unimaginable. For example, ceramic 3D printing is enabling the creation of complex, custom-designed architectural elements. Additionally, ultra-thin ceramic panels are being used to create lightweight, yet strong, facades that can be easily installed and maintained.
